According to the leaks, Rogue is a Strategist character within Marvel Rivals who uses her powers of absorption to empower herself and weaken her enemies. Just like other Marvel Rivals strategists, the character will focus on support using her unique power set.

With NetEase planning to properly represent every character they can with unique power sets, Rogue should also be able to fly through the battlefield and absorb other heroes’ powers in some form.

All Rogue Abilities in Marvel Rivals

Alongside the character’s role, Rogue’s abilities have been leaked in their entirety, but there are still changes that NetEase could make. Despite that, the leaked powers provide a great look at a solid adaptation for the character in the multiplayer game.

Rogue’s abilities are as follows:

  • Ability Draw – Rogue is able to copy the abilities of nearby heroes to use for herself. Rogue can store three of these abilities to use until death.
  • Ability Acquisition – Skill 1 – Rogue’s first stolen ability
  • Ability Acqusition – Skill 2 – Rogue’s second stolen ability
  • Ability Acquisition – Skill 3 – Rogue’s third stolen ability
  • Capacity Building – a passive skill that increases energy by absorbing attacks within the match
